Hotel Description
The Brambletye Hotel, located at The Square, Lewes Rd, Forest Row RH18 5EZ, United Kingdom, is a charming and classic 19th-century pub and B&B that offers a welcoming and rustic atmosphere. Situated just 4 miles from the Standen Arts and Crafts mansion and 8 miles from the stunning Royal Botanic Gardens at Wakehurst, this delightful hotel places guests in close proximity to both nature and history. The rooms at The Brambletye Hotel are thoughtfully designed to provide a warm and comfortable environment. Each room is equipped with essential amenities such as en suite bathrooms, free Wi-Fi, a TV, and tea and coffeemaking facilities, ensuring that guests have everything they need for a pleasant stay. The decor combines classic and modern elements, offering a homely ambiance that invites relaxation. Some rooms also offer garden or countryside views, enhancing the overall experience. A complimentary full English breakfast is included, providing a great start to the day, and guests can also enjoy the traditional pub atmosphere, complete with a carvery and locally sourced dishes.

The hotel is ideally situated to offer guests a variety of exciting activities and experiences. For outdoor enthusiasts, the Ashdown Forest provides an idyllic setting for hiking, picnicking, and wildlife spotting. Guests can also explore nearby landmarks such as Hever Castle, the childhood home of Anne Boleyn, and the Bluebell Railway, a heritage steam railway that offers an unforgettable experience for history buffs and train enthusiasts alike.
